Checklist for Compliance with §461 Permits to Operate for Pressure Tanks in Green Energy

Ensuring compliance with §461 Permits to Operate for pressure tanks is critical in the green energy sector. This checklist is designed to guide mid-sized to enterprise businesses through the process of achieving and maintaining compliance, safeguarding both the environment and employee safety.

Understanding §461 Permits to Operate

Before diving into the checklist, it's crucial to understand what §461 entails. This regulation governs the operation of pressure tanks used in green energy applications, ensuring they meet safety and environmental standards. Compliance with this permit is not just about meeting legal requirements; it's about demonstrating a commitment to safety and sustainability in your operations.

Compliance Checklist

Here's a step-by-step checklist to help your business become compliant with §461 Permits to Operate for pressure tanks in the green energy sector:

1. Review Current Operations

  • Conduct a thorough review of all pressure tanks currently in use within your green energy operations.
  • Identify any tanks that fall under the §461 regulation.

2. Documentation and Record Keeping

  • Ensure all necessary documentation for each pressure tank is up to date, including maintenance logs, inspection reports, and operational guidelines.
  • Keep records of any modifications or repairs made to the tanks.

3. Safety Training and Protocols

  • Implement comprehensive safety training programs for all employees who operate or work near pressure tanks.
  • Develop and enforce strict safety protocols aligned with §461 requirements.

4. Regular Inspections and Maintenance

  • Schedule regular inspections by qualified personnel to ensure tanks meet §461 standards.
  • Establish a routine maintenance schedule to prevent potential hazards.

5. Permit Application and Renewal

  • Apply for §461 Permits to Operate through the appropriate regulatory agency.
  • Stay on top of permit renewal deadlines to avoid lapses in compliance.

6. Environmental Impact Assessment

  • Conduct an environmental impact assessment to ensure your pressure tanks do not adversely affect the environment.
  • Implement measures to mitigate any identified risks.

7. Incident Reporting and Response

  • Develop a clear incident reporting system for any issues related to pressure tanks.
  • Establish an emergency response plan to handle any incidents swiftly and effectively.
